Swiss International Air Lines AG (SWISS) is Switzerland's leading premium airline, operating direct flights from Zurich and Geneva with one of Europe's most advanced aircraft fleets. As a member of the Lufthansa Group, SWISS connects cultures and creates unique travel experiences, driving sustainable aviation for guests, employees, and society. The Taxation team sits at the intersection of accounting, law, and finance, tackling complex compliance and consulting challenges across Swiss tax regulations. Support the Taxation team in daily business operations and independently conduct smaller projects. Research and answer tax-related queries to gain familiarity with various Swiss tax regulations. Assist with tax compliance tasks, primarily in Corporate Tax, VAT, and Customs. Monitor changes in tax laws and assess their implications to keep the team up to date. Plan and implement individually assigned small tax projects from start to finish. Help with the preparation and organisation of team meetings and similar events. Bachelor's or Master's degree (or similar education) in law, business administration, or economics, preferably with a specialisation in taxation. Ability to drive new topics independently. Strong analytical skills. Open, agile, and flexible working style. Very good spoken and written German and English. IT affinity and very good MS Office skills. A steep learning curve in an exciting, dynamic, and international environment within the aviation industry. Opportunity to take responsibility from day one and develop both organisational and social skills. Competitive monthly salary of CHF 2,500 gross (Bachelor/Advanced Federal Diploma students or graduates) or CHF 3,000 gross (Master students or graduates). Benefits include subsidised parking or public transport, company health management, 25 days of annual vacation, flight benefits, employee and networking events, remote working options, flexible working hours and part-time models, discounts, and diversity programmes. The internship runs 3–12 months at 40–100% pensum, with a flexible start date around 1 October 2026.
